FAQs for booking flights from London to Shannon

  • Can I get Special Assistance at London and Shannon's airports?

    All departure and arrival airports can provide Special Assistance including airport guides and mobility equipment. Just make sure to book at least 48 hours in advance through your airline. This way, you can get assistance all the way through your trip.

  • Where is the car hire centre at Shannon Airport (SNN)?

    Having a car is a great way to explore Ireland and you can pick one up easily at Shannon Airport. There are multiple major companies available, with desks in the Arrivals Hall. Their pick-up area is just outside the terminal.

  • Is there a short-stay car park at Shannon Airport?

    If someone is coming to pick you up at Shannon Airport they can use the short-stay car park. It's free for the first 15 minute, so it's a good idea to make sure they know your flight number and can check to see if there are any delays.

  • Which other cities are near Shannon Airport?

    You may also fly into Shannon Airport if you're planning on heading to Limerick, roughly half an hour east of Shannon. There's a direct bus from the airport to Limerick with multiple departures each day. There are also buses that run directly from Shannon Airport to Galway and Cork.

  • Can I find direct flights from London airports to Shannon Airport?

    Yes, you can fly direct from three airports in London to Shannon. With London Heathrow Airport, London Gatwick Airport, and London Stansted Airport offering regular flights with airlines such as Ryanair and Aer Lingus, you’ll be at your destination in no time at all.

  • Can I fast-track at London airports?

    To make sure you aren’t in a rush at the airport, you can get a fast track to ensure you fly through security. For around £12.50 at Heathrow Airport, or £5 Gatwick and Stansted, you can ensure that you are not held up by queues. All you need to do is book 24h in advance and show your QR code on arrival during the time slot you are given.

  • Are there currency exchange bureaus available upon arrival at Shannon Airport?

    Shannon Airport has a range of currency exchange options for you when you land in Ireland. You can either use the ATMs located in the arrivals hall to withdraw Euros for your trip, or you can visit the International Currency Exchange office in the customs hall of the airport to exchange your Pounds Sterling for Euros.

  • How can I get from Shannon Airport to Shannon?

    You can get a bus from the airport to the city centre, which will take you about 10min and cost about €2.40 (£2.10). You should get on the 343 bus towards Limerick, which can be found just in front of the airport. You can also walk the distance in about 1h, should your bags not be too heavy.

Top tips for finding a cheap flight from London to Shannon

  • Looking for a cheap flight from London to Shannon? 25% of our users found flights on this route for £23 or less one-way and £43 or less round-trip.
  • London Heathrow (LHR), London Gatwick (LGW) and London Stansted (STN), all have express trains from Central London to the airport. Stansted departs from Liverpool Street Station, Gatwick from Victoria Station and Heathrow from Paddington Station. They're more expensive so Heathrow may be the best budget option as the Elizabeth Line from Paddington takes around 35 minutes.
  • All of London's airports have lounges available to all passengers for an extra fee. Heathrow has the most lounge options, as well as the more expensive options. If you fly Business Class with British Airways, they have 15 lounges across Heathrow's terminals.
  • There are 3 airports that offer direct flights from London to Shannon Airport. If you fly from Heathrow Airport, you have easy access from the city centre, whereas Stansted Airport is good for those in north London and Gatwick is good for those in the south of the city.
  • From Shannon Airport, not only are you in a great position to see Shannon itself, but you are also well positioned to see other places too. Limerick is about 25min away by car, whilst Galway is around a 1h drive away.
  • Ahead of your flight from London, you can relax at one of the lounges at London Airports. At London Heathrow and London Gatwick, you can pay about £25 to use a lounge like Aspire Lounge, which offers complimentary food and drinks as well as Wi-Fi. Similarly, at Stansted, you can get these facilities at Escape Lounge for about £20.
  • Make sure you have exchanged your currency ahead of your flight to Shannon, so you can get going as soon as you land. At Heathrow Terminals 2, 3, and 4 you can use a Travelex desk, and at Terminal 5 there is a Moneycorp. For those flying direct from Gatwick or Stansted Airport, you can use an International Currency Exchange bureau. These are located prominently in the departure areas, so you won't find them hard to locate.
